Integration with the Governor
The governor is a device that maintains the engine’s speed by adjusting the fuel supply. In traditional mechanical systems, this was achieved through physical linkages and springs. However, in contemporary engines, the 5338335 Electrical Governor Actuator replaces these mechanical components with an electronic interface.
When the engine speed deviates from the set point, the electronic governor sends a signal to the 5338335 Actuator. This actuator then adjusts the fuel rack position, thereby modifying the fuel supply to the engine. This dynamic adjustment ensures that the engine operates within the desired speed range under varying load conditions.
Interaction with Electronic Control Units (ECUs)
In engine systems equipped with Electronic Control Units (ECUs), the 5338335 Actuator plays a pivotal role in the feedback loop. The ECU monitors various engine parameters such as speed, load, and temperature. It processes this data and sends commands to the 5338335 Actuator to make real-time adjustments.
For instance, during acceleration, the ECU detects an increase in load and commands the actuator to increase fuel supply. Conversely, during deceleration, the ECU reduces the fuel supply to match the lower demand. This precise control enhances fuel efficiency, reduces emissions, and improves overall engine performance.
Enhanced Performance and Efficiency
The integration of the 5338335 Electrical Governor Actuator with the governor and ECU allows for more sophisticated engine management strategies. Features such as idle speed control, load sensing, and transient response are significantly improved.
Idle speed control ensures that the engine maintains a stable RPM when at rest, which is essential for applications like generators and auxiliary power units. Load sensing allows the engine to adjust fuel delivery based on the current demand, optimizing performance under varying conditions. Transient response refers to the engine’s ability to quickly adapt to changes in load or speed, which is critical for smooth operation in dynamic environments.
